I posted up on the gmc Facebook group but figured I’d post up here as well. I just picked up a 2007 GMC Yukon 2500 SLT2 6 liter with 108k miles on it. I bought it private party for $13,500 from the original owner. He had every single service record from day one and I believe he was a pretty particular guy with keeping up to date with maintenace. I just wanted to get your thoughts on the purchase and see if there was anything that inneeded to keep a eye on or any preventative maintenace that I needed to do? Here are some pictures

Not trying to make light of a serious subject, but the word is shrapnel. ;)

GM is claiming that the airbag modules made by Takata were custom-made to GM specs, with thicker housings, and less likely to break apart. I'd be curious to see a list of vehicles where deaths/injuries occurred. But honestly I don't really think twice about it, and the Suburban is still the family truckster.

Simple way to see if the heated washer fluid was disabled - push the button. If it's functioning the button light will flash a few times and then the washer/wipers will cycle. That was a pretty serious recall, I doubt many vehicles slipped through without it.

Alphatherm makes the replacement heated washer fluid unit. I have one in my '08 Suburban and it works well. Was also a very simple install.

What do you guys think if I were to put these 2018 20” Denali wheels on it instead? Would it look better?

View attachment 214797 View attachment 214798

Those are nice, but won't fit your 07. I think 2011 GM changed stuff and the lug pattern is different. When I worked at a chevy dealer a few years back, a guy traded his 07 2500hd on a 2013 and wanted his wheels swapped. I went to put the 2013 wheels on his 07 and they would not go on.

I found this information on gmtrucks to make sure I'm remembering correctly:


'With the 2011 redesign came a new lug pattern (8 x 180mm). Until then, all HD trucks used a standard 8 x 6.5" pattern since the dawn of time'
